Historical Perspective on Technology Development

To fully appreciate the significance of Technology, it is imperative to trace its historical roots. From the discovery of fire and the invention of the wheel to the dawn of the internet and the rise of artificial intelligence, technological advancements represent milestones in human history. The industrial revolution marked a turning point, introducing mass production and mechanization, forever changing our economic landscapes. In the 20th century, the advent of personal computing revolutionized communication and access to information, heralding a new era of digital connectivity.

Biotechnology: Innovations in Medicine and Agriculture

Biotechnology represents a fusion of biological research and technological applications aimed at improving health outcomes and agricultural yields. In medicine, breakthroughs in genetic engineering and personalized medicine have revolutionized patient care by creating tailored treatment plans. In agriculture, biotechnology enables the development of genetically modified organisms (GMOs) that can resist pests, reduce the need for chemical fertilizers, and enhance nutritional content in staple crops. This dual focus on health and sustainability emphasizes biotechnology’s critical role in addressing global challenges.

Renewable Energy Technologies and Sustainability

As the world grapples with climate change, renewable energy technologies have emerged as essential solutions for sustainable development. Solar, wind, hydroelectric, and geothermal energies provide alternatives to fossil fuels, reducing carbon footprints and promoting environmental stewardship. Innovations in energy storage and smart grid technology improve the efficiency and reliability of renewable energy systems, making them increasingly viable for widespread adoption. The transition toward clean energy technologies not only aids in curbing greenhouse gas emissions but also fosters economic resilience through job creation in emerging sectors.

Privacy Concerns in the Digital Age

In a world increasingly dominated by digital interactions, privacy concerns have come to the forefront. Organizations that collect, store, and utilize personal data must navigate the complexities of consumer trust and regulatory compliance. Data breaches and surveillance practices have prompted calls for stringent privacy laws that protect user information and ensure transparency in data handling. Balancing the benefits of data-driven technologies with the right to personal privacy continues to challenge policymakers and businesses alike.

The Impact of Social Media on Public Discourse

Social media platforms have revolutionized how individuals engage in public discourse, enabling dynamic interactions and the rapid dissemination of information. However, this democratization of information also bears risks, such as the propagation of misinformation and the cultivation of echo chambers that inhibit diverse viewpoints. As society grapples with these challenges, it becomes essential to develop media literacy skills and promote platforms that encourage constructive dialogue rather than divisive rhetoric.
